| Burning Bridges
Your bridges engulfed
in flames
and in panic, you try to run back across,
thinking your life was safer, maybe
even better while still on the other side.
Disaster! The bridge crashes into the river
and you fall to your knees, wailing:
you cannot go back; are afraid to move
onto face unknown challenges that lie ahead
in the unexplored country.
As you watch the
mighty river
wash away remnants of your bridge,
a spirit appears in the smoky air,
beckoning you to accept the inevitable.
"You can never relive the past:
why be afraid to let your bridges burn?
The road of life has no round trip fare:
all your paths are but one-way streets."
Learn to rejoice
at the end of each road,
at the crossing of each stream and river;
laugh at the fall of burning bridges!
Why should you care about so-called
wisdom which says,
"'Don't burn your bridges?"
If I can teach anything at all,
it's that no life is possible
without burning bridges!
Every experience forges a new link
in the chain of life,
moving ever forward towards
man's final destiny:
there can never be a turning back
once you begin your walk in Earth's domain.
